Our verdict is Likely benign. Variant got -2 ACMG points: 2P and 4B. PM2BP4_Strong

The NM_006274.3(CCL19):ā€‹c.46C>Gā€‹(p.Pro16Ala) variant causes a missense change involving the alteration of a non-conserved nucleotide. The variant allele was found at a frequency of 0.00000823 in 1,457,356 control chromosomes in the GnomAD database, with no homozygous occurrence. In-silico tool predicts a benign outcome for this variant. 14/20 in silico tools predict a benign outcome for this variant. Variant has been reported in ClinVar as Uncertain significance (ā˜…).

Genes affected
CCL19 (HGNC:10617): (C-C motif chemokine ligand 19) This antimicrobial gene is one of several CC cytokine genes clustered on the p-arm of chromosome 9. Cytokines are a family of secreted proteins involved in immunoregulatory and inflammatory processes. The CC cytokines are proteins characterized by two adjacent cysteines. The cytokine encoded by this gene may play a role in normal lymphocyte recirculation and homing. It also plays an important role in trafficking of T cells in thymus, and in T cell and B cell migration to secondary lymphoid organs. It specifically binds to chemokine receptor CCR7. Uncertain significance, criteria provided, single submitterclinical testingAmbry GeneticsJul 05, 2023The c.46C>G (p.P16A) alteration is located in exon 1 (coding exon 1) of the CCL19 gene. This alteration results from a C to G substitution at nucleotide position 46, causing the proline (P) at amino acid position 16 to be replaced by an alanine (A). Based on insufficient or conflicting evidence, the clinical significance of this alteration remains unclear. -
